Why Toe-Kicking in Soccer is a Bad Habit and How to …

WebToe Kick: Kicking the ball using the front or toe end of the foot, but should be avoided because of its difficulty to control. Toe Poke: Poking the ball with the front foot, as opposed to the "toe kick"; the preferred method because of a player's ability to control it, and should generally be used by a player in a position to "steal" the ball ... WebMar 8, 2024 · Kick with the the largest bone in your foot, or the first metatarsal, which is just above the big toe knuckle. This translates into the most force or energy at impact. Find: Kids Soccer Camps & Clinics Near … WebApr 14, 2013 · How would you kick a soccer ball? Definitely do NOT kick the ball with your toe. This could result in breaks, bruises and fractures of the toes and foot. You should always kick the ball with the inside part of your foot, (the curved part) This action should be a lot like playing hockey with a hockey puck.

WebWhen Kicking A Soccer Ball For Power 1. Use Your Laces The top of your foot (where your laces are) is where you want to aim to get the most power behind your shot. 2. Land On Your Shooting Foot If you are striking the ball with the right momentum and technique you will be landing on the same foot you are shooting with first.
